SV1 & SV2 – How It Works
Just like the one-way Scupper Valve on a boat, the lower section of both the SV1 and SV2 enable water to be easily expelled. An internal tube (1) located inside the main snorkel body contains a small one-way Scupper flap valve (2) designed to allow water to flow past the mouthpiece and out the purge valve (3) without collecting at the bottom of the breathing passage. The diver simply exhales a small burst of air to clear any water trapped below the mouthpiece, and the internal tube airway is kept dry. It’s so simple and so effective Atomic has a patent pending!

SV: Scupper Valve
The Atomic Aquatics Scupper Valve snorkel design is based on the same principle as the one-way Scupper Valve used in boats. If waves or splashes enter the boat, a one-way rubber flapper located on the deck near the rear of the boat opens to drain the water then quickly closes to prevent backwash. The simple Scupper Valve effectively keeps the deck free of water accumulation.

SV2: High-Performance Design with a Semi-Dry Top
Designed to limit splashed water from entering the breathing tube. Perfect for use in choppy waves.

The SV2 combines the same Scupper Valve lower section with the sleek and effective SV2 Semi-Dry top. The SV2 Semi-Dry top horizontal vents (1) are engineered to diffuse splashed water that would normally freely enter the snorkel top. The small gaps between the vanes (2) of the vent restrict water speed and droplet size and permit most of the splashed water to exit the special vents (3) without entering the breathing tube. Thus, you get less water in your snorkel. The SV2 is the perfect answer for rough or choppy water conditions.
